On Thu, Jun 16, 2011 at 6:53 AM, Jonathan <[email protected]> wrote: > I've run into a nice variant of this just this morning....the window is > titled, "Windows Vista Restore" and the caption at the top of the window > says, "PC Performance & Stability analysis report". It is telling me hat the > hard drive is failing and that private data is at risk. > > When I went into the root of C:. it only showed one file, named > bootsect.bak. Continual >> > re-infestation either means he is unlucky, or gung-ho in his browsing. >> > >> > I've had some fake AVs recently which were ridiculously easy to get rid >> of >> > (kill process, delete files, remove autorun entry). Others have been >> more >> > stealthy - such as killing targeted windows like Task Manager. Booting >> into >> > safe mode usually prevents these extra "features" from bothering you. >> > >> > But as with everything - a reimage may be the only way to be sure. >> > On 3 June 2011 15:26, John Aldrich <[email protected]> >> wrote: >> > I'm going to go to a former co-worker's this afternoon to clean his >> system >> > (again) from another fake antivirus infestation.
